Elon Musk Lives in a 36 m² Prefabricated House

Elon Musk and His Real Estate Revolution: From Million-Dollar Mansions to a $50,000 USD House

In a world where luxury is often measured by square footage, ocean views, and eight-digit figures, Elon Musk—the richest man in the world—opts for a way of living that both baffles and inspires. With an estimated fortune of US$342 billion,Musk lives in a prefabricated house measuring just 36 m² in Boca Chica, Texas. A contradiction? Not for him. It's a statement.

The Radical Decision: Less Square Footage, More Purpose

Since 2020, Musk has lived in a house designed by Boxabl,, a company specializing in modular and transportable housing. For just US$50,000,this one-room "little house" includes a kitchen, a full bathroom, a living room area, and a bedroom space separated by a piece of furniture. It's leased to his own company, SpaceX, and is located in Boca Chica, the epicenter of his space ambitions.

In his own words, Musk stated in 2021 on X (formerly Twitter):

"My primary residence is a $50,000 house in Boca Chica/Starbase that I rent to SpaceX. It's great.”

Journalist Walter Isaacson, author of his official biography, revealed that Musk chose this spartan home as his primary residence years ago. His approach: efficiency, functionality, and focus.

From Legendary Mansions to Zero Properties

Until 2020, Elon Musk owned an impressive real estate portfolio that included seven mansions in Los Angeles. In a dramatic plot twist, he announced he would sell “almost all of his physical possessions,”keeping his word.

  • He sold a 15,000 square foot mansion in Bel-Air for $29 million dollars..
  • Another iconic property: Gene Wilder's house, which he sold for $7 million to the actor's family, under the condition that it not be demolished.
  • Among others, Musk owned a ranch, a colonial house, and an unfinished residence, all in exclusive areas.

The final jewel: a 16,000 square meter mansion in Hillsborough, California,featuring a leather library, a dance floor with gold-leaf molding, a professional kitchen, and spectacular views. It sold for US$40.8 million.

Total detachment? Not quite.

Although his narrative seems to be one of total renunciation of luxury, Musk still maintains strategic properties. In 2022, he purchased a 15,000 square meter mansion in Austin to reunite his family. Directly behind it, he owns another 6,500 square meter house.He is also said to frequent a third mansion nearby.

The total cost: US$35 million for the two main ones.
